WAM's Kiss My Camera Competition
The competition celebrates the work of live music photographers in Western Australia.
Entry Details: The competition is typically free to enter and open to photographers of all skill levels.
Categories: It features categories like Best Portrait/Press Shot and Best Live Photograph of a WA act, often including a category for touring acts.
